What counts as an emergency treatment course in Australia
When individuals state first aid Maryborough, they normally suggest nationally identified systems from the Health Training Package. The 3 most common are:
- HLTAID009 Offer cardiopulmonary resuscitation, frequently noted as a CPR course Maryborough or CPR training Maryborough. This focuses on adult, child, and baby CPR and defibrillation. HLTAID011 Supply First Aid, frequently the default Maryborough first aid course for offices. It covers recognition and reaction throughout a broad range of injuries and illnesses plus CPR. HLTAID012 Offer Emergency treatment in an education and care setting, the child care and education version that maps to early childhood and school environments. Many listings identify it emergency treatment and CPR course Maryborough for child care or first aid and CPR courses Maryborough for educators.
These come from registered training organisations that run nationally. If you see Maryborough emergency treatment courses advertised by St John, Red Cross, Emergency Treatment Pro Maryborough, or other RTOs, the material needs to line up with those unit codes. The code matters more than the brand name. It is what appears on your declaration of attainment and what employers recognise.

Course types and typical duration
Most service providers in Maryborough provide combined knowing. You total knowledge parts online at your own pace, then participate in a much shorter face to deal with assessment and useful workshop. Totally face to face days still exist, usually preferred for group reservations or for students who struggle with online modules.
Here is how the common options normally break down in practice:
- HLTAID009 CPR: online learning 1 to 2 hours, practical workshop 1.5 to 2 hours. Some providers run an express 60 to 90 minute practical session if you have strong prior knowledge and end up the eLearning thoroughly. HLTAID011 Provide First Aid: online knowing 3 to 6 hours depending on your familiarity, useful workshop 3.5 to 5 hours. Expect a half day in person if you finish a robust pre-course. HLTAID012 Childcare Emergency treatment: online learning 4 to 7 hours, useful workshop 4 to 6 hours. There is extra focus on anaphylaxis and asthma management, child-specific circumstances, and reporting.
If you are new to first aid, prepare for the longer end of each range so you are not hurried. Seasoned learners who complete the eLearning effectively frequently sail through the shorter useful sessions since they spend less time revisiting basics in class.
For clarity at a glance, here is a compact picture that the majority of Maryborough emergency treatment training learners discover holds true.
- CPR just, HLTAID009: 2 to 4 total hours split in between eLearning and a brief class Provide First Aid, HLTAID011: 6 to 10 total hours with a half day in person Childcare Emergency treatment, HLTAID012: 7 to 12 overall hours with a longer half day in person Express formats: available if you finish all online knowledge and demonstrate competency quickly Full face to deal with day: still offered, often 6.5 to 8 hours on site without pre-study
Those timeframes show adult finding out pace, not a stopwatch. Fitness instructors in Maryborough stay with proficiency. If a class requires an extra 20 minutes to duplicate CPR cycles till everyone is comfortable, a great fitness instructor makes time.

What your certificate indicates and how long it stays valid
When you complete first aid training in Maryborough with an RTO, you get a statement of attainment listing the unit code, your name, the RTO number, and the date of issue. Employers identify these certificates throughout Australia. Digital copies arrive rapidly, typically within the same day after the trainer finalises results and administration checks your USI.
Validity can be found in two parts. There is no single law that makes a certificate expire, however, industry standards and work environment guidelines set expectations for currency.
- CPR validity: The Australian Resuscitation Council advises refreshing CPR skills every 12 months. A lot of offices embrace that requirement. If you hold HLTAID011 or HLTAID012, the embedded CPR component is thought about current for one year. A CPR refresher course Maryborough keeps that piece up to date. First Aid validity: Safe Work Australia and typical market practice think about HLTAID011 and HLTAID012 existing for three years. Numerous employers anticipate a full emergency treatment refresher by the third anniversary of your certificate date, with annual CPR in between.
A few sectors push stricter timelines. Child care and education services, assisted by ACECQA, lean tough on currency for anaphylaxis and asthma management. Some construction and mining sites in regional Queensland request proof of CPR revitalized within the past 6 to 12 months, specifically for designated first aiders. When in doubt, ask your employer or customer what their safety system requires.

What impacts duration on the day
Not all two hour CPR classes feel the same. Providers build in time for the essential evaluation tasks required by the unit:
- Two continuous minutes of chest compressions on an adult manikin while connected to a defibrillator trainer, then 2 minutes on an infant manikin. Trainers enjoy depth, rate, recoil, and hand placement. Safe use of an AED including pad positioning and following triggers. You do not deliver a live shock, however you require to replicate the process easily and continue CPR when advised. Scenario work such as choking, healing position, and calling for help.
For HLTAID011 and HLTAID012, anticipate added assessment for bleeding control, splinting, burns cooling and dressing, asthma first aid using a puffer and spacer, anaphylaxis using an adrenaline vehicle injector trainer, and incident reporting. If the group has a large range of experience, a skilled trainer will rate the day so newer learners get time to practice without tiring those with years on the job. That judgment becomes part of what you pay for.

The assessment requirement, without the mystery
Many very first time learners stress they are going to be put on the spot. Great fitness instructors construct confidence action by action. They demonstrate, then have you practice in sets, then assess one by one. The speed is constant and helpful. If you do not nail the two minute CPR on your first effort, the assessor lets you rest, coaches specific changes, and reassesses. Competency does not suggest https://privatebin.net/?c1f0b54d0e105441#nAS5D4U6oaLKeegGZK9kHaR9CWnTkjksoyWU2Yi4KSn excellence. It means you can carry out the essential actions safely and reliably.
Expect brief situation sheets and a handful of multiple choice knowledge checks if your provider runs a totally face to face day. In combined courses, most theory is already covered online. The fitness instructor may review one or two concerns that lots of learners got wrong in the eLearning and talk through why, for example, the length of time to cool a burn under running water or when to call Triple Absolutely no versus self-transport.

Special cases: child care, sport, and high danger work
HLTAID012 sits apart due to the fact that childcare guidelines include layers. If you work in early learning, outdoors school hours care, or prep classrooms, your Maryborough first aid course must plainly consist of asthma and anaphylaxis management mapped to your setting. That suggests spacer strategy, completing a sample event report for moms and dads, and aligning your actions with service policies. Some service providers set HLTAID012 with kid protection or compulsory reporting micro-courses. Those bundles can make good sense if you are starting a brand-new function and want to cover compliance in one go.
Coaches and club volunteers in Maryborough frequently stick to HLTAID011 plus annual CPR. If your club preserves an AED at the oval, ask your fitness instructor to run an AED familiarisation with your particular design. Pads vary in their packaging and cable routing. The maker will still talk you through it, however 5 minutes of hands-on practice with your exact unit smooths out surprises on game day.
If you work around live electrical power, heights, or mobile plant, take a look at how your business's threat evaluation frames emergency treatment. Designated initially aiders sometimes need staged training so that a minimum of one proficient individual is constantly rostered on. Scheduling half the group for the exact same date leads to a protection gap. Spread sessions across two weeks even if it costs a little more in admin time.

Certificates, USIs, and the administrative nuts and bolts
You require a Distinct Student Identifier to get a nationally acknowledged certificate. Develop or obtain it at the official USI site before you book. Utilize the exact same legal name on your booking, your USI, and your ID. Mismatched names are the most typical factor certificates are delayed.
Most RTOs email a PDF declaration of achievement within hours of class completion. Some likewise upload to a student portal where you can download previous training for insurance audits or job applications. If you prefer a printed card or wallet certificate, check if there is a little fee and extra postage time.
Keep your certificates organised. Save the file with a clear name, for example, "HLTAID011 Jane Smith 2026-03-15 Maryborough.pdf". A minute of tidy filing now saves an hour of rummaging when a new agreement requests evidence with 2 days' notice.

How to analyze marketing language without getting lost
Phrases like express emergency treatment, fast track assessment, or refreshers can be slippery. An express class is not a faster way around proficiency. It just presumes you have actually completed extensive online knowing and will move quickly through presentations and assessments. A refresher for first aid usually implies you are re-certifying HLTAID011 or HLTAID012 within three years, however the training and assessment are the exact same as a very first timer. A CPR refresher is genuinely shorter since the system itself is shorter.
When ads mention exact same day certificates, checked out the fine print. It typically depends upon you completing all components and the system validating your USI. If administration can not verify your USI or your name has a typo, a certificate can hold up until the next business day. Avoid that by inspecting your details before class.
